Pipedrive
Pipedrive is a CRM that's designed specifically for sales teams. It's simple and easy to use, and it comes with a variety of features that can help sales teams close more deals. Pipedrive also integrates with a variety of other business tools, making it a great option for businesses that use a lot of different software.
Features
Pipedrive comes with a variety of features that can help sales teams close more deals. Some of the most notable features include:
- A visual sales pipeline that helps sales teams track their progress on deals
- Integrations with a variety of email providers, so sales teams can track emails and see when prospects open them
- A mobile app that sales teams can use to access their CRM data on the go
Ease of Use
Pipedrive is designed to be simple and easy to use. The visual sales pipeline makes it easy to track deals, and the integrations with email providers make it easy to track prospects. The mobile app is also easy to use, and it gives sales teams the ability to access their CRM data on the go.
Integrations
Pipedrive integrates with a variety of other business tools, making it a great option for businesses that use a lot of different software. Some of the most popular integrations include:
- Email providers like Gmail and Outlook
- Calendar apps like Google Calendar and Apple Calendar
- Project management tools like Asana and Trello
- Billing and invoicing software like FreshBooks and QuickBooks
